Immunology Thought Leader Liaison SLE Rheumatology
About the Role
Biogen is seeking an Immunology Thought Leader Liaison (TLL) Lead with deep Rheumatology experience to support the launch readiness and commercialization of our emerging Systemic Lupus Erythematosus (SLE) product.
This field-based role is responsible for expanding Biogen's influence within the rheumatology community by engaging Key Medical Experts (KMEs), generating critical insights, and strengthening Biogen's position as a scientific and commercial leader in SLE.
You will play a pivotal role in shaping strategy across disease education, advocacy, content development, congress presence, and advisory engagements, ensuring Biogen is fully prepared for future lupus launches.
